Synopsis: kitty-logging [install|uninstall|status|dismiss] [-h]
+
+Manages the Kitty scrollback watcher that powers C5 logging. Ships a
+canonical, version-marked watcher and installs it into the Kitty config
+directory, wiring it into kitty.conf through a sentinel-marked managed
+block. Commenting out any conflicting watcher line avoids double-capture.
+
+Commands:
+ install Copy/refresh the watcher and add the managed block
+ uninstall Remove the managed block and the watcher file
+ status Show wiring, installed watcher version, and C5 state
+ dismiss Stop the per-session setup reminder
+
+Runtime capture stays governed by the C5 .logging_disabled sentinel, so
+disabling __fish_config_op_logging makes the watcher inert without
+uninstalling. Install affects new Kitty windows only.
+
+Example:
+ kitty-logging install
+ kitty-logging status
